Schneider Electric and DataCentre UK deploy modular data centre for South Warwickshire NHS Trust

Schneider Electric, in partnership with its EcoXpert Partner DataCentre UK, has successfully implemented a new modular data centre for South Warwickshire University NHS Foundation Trust (SWFT). This strategic deployment enhances the Trust’s operational resilience, energy efficiency, and capacity to meet evolving healthcare demands.

In response to increasing pressures on existing infrastructure, SWFT sought a robust, scalable, and secure data centre solution. Schneider Electric’s EcoStruxure™ Data Centre platform, including APC NetShelter racks, modular cooling units, APC power distribution units (PDUs), and Easy UPS systems, was selected to optimize resilience, efficiency, and sustainability.

“We integrated Schneider Electric’s EcoStruxure Data Centre solutions into the design—these pre-engineered, configurable, and scalable systems encompass racks, power, cooling, and management, all aimed at maximizing resiliency and environmental sustainability. The trust trusted our expertise and approved the build,” said Paul Almond, MD of DataCentre UK and an EcoXpert Partner.

The new infrastructure has delivered notable energy reductions, cutting data centre power costs by at least 60% compared to previous setups. Its proactive monitoring features ensure continuous performance optimization, aligning with SWFT’s Green Plan initiatives.

“Our system was built around sustainability. We are conservatively using 60% less electricity for the same IT load, with an expected annualized Power Usage Effectiveness (PUE) of 1.2,” said Mike Conlon, Associate Director of Technology Services at Innovate Healthcare Services.

The deployment included a comprehensive 365-day maintenance and support agreement managed jointly by DataCentre UK and Schneider Electric, ensuring ongoing operational excellence.

“Data centres are critical to healthcare delivery, so reliability, scalability, and sustainability are paramount. Our solutions have enabled SWFT to significantly improve their environmental footprint while ensuring exceptional operational performance — building a resilient environment for the future of healthcare,” said Karlton Gray, Director of Channels for UK & Ireland at Schneider Electric.

This deployment exemplifies how advanced data centre solutions can drive digital transformation, enhance patient care, and foster continuous innovation within healthcare environments.
